What flowers are suitable for a funeral?
Choosing the right one Flowers
Cloves, chrysanthemums, gladioli, lilies and roses are popular choices for funeral flower preparation. White lilies represent tranquility and red roses are famous for expressing love.
What color of flowers are you giving for death?
White flowers they are commonly sent as sacrifices of compassion because they mean purity, peace and love. Simple white flowers flatter the surroundings at any funeral ceremony. Common white cut flowers Sent in compassion, they include compassionate lilies, white roses, orchids, and irises.

What color does death mean in Japan?
1 Black. Black is powerful and ominous color in Japanese language culture. Traditionally, she represented black death, destruction, annihilation, fear and sadness. Especially when used alone, black represents mourning and misfortune and is often worn at funerals.
